Claim:
A MAGA supporter in Iowa accidentally burned down his house in June 2024 while trying to set fire to a Pride flag.
Rating:
Labeled Satire ( About this rating? )
On June 12, 2024, the X account @HalfwayPost claimed a "MAGA fan" — referring to supporters of former President Donald Trump who use the slogan "Make America Great Again" — in Iowa accidentally burned down his house that day while trying to set fire to a Pride flag.
The post had amassed more than 11.7 million views at the time of this writing.
Other X users replying to the post appeared to believe the story was true, with one writing : "Karma doesn't miss."
Another said: "Please say this is real."
Similar posts appeared elsewhere on X , on Facebook and in multiple Reddit posts .
One Facebook user wrote: "Could've avoided that one by being a good person."
https://www.facebook.com/michaelb.field.752/posts/pfbid03Qj5jYLYqJ6zwa7G2GZSGHr9hCRqi63vCh2KKJESnzW3oPpDiTUXtnUtKNvHN8qAl
However, this item was not a factual recounting of real-life events. The claim originated from the The Halfway Post X account , which described its output as satirical in nature, as follows:
Halfway true comedy and satire by @DashMacIntyre. I don't report the facts, I improve them.
On his X account , Dash Macintyre described himself as a comedian who published "satirical Dada news."
A follow-up X post by The Halfway Post said: "The MAGA fan in Iowa who accidentally burned down his house yesterday trying to burn a gay pride flag today set his truck on fire trying to burn a DVD of Brokeback Mountain."
